π Local Knowledge
St Brevin l'Ermitage in Loire Atlantique is an exposed beach break that has reasonably consistent surf. Winter is the optimum time of year for surfing here. Offshore winds are from the east northeast. Tends to receive a mix of groundswells and windswells and the optimum swell angle is from the west southwest. Waves at the beach are both lefts and rights. It very rarely gets crowded here. Beware of - Man-made danger (buoys etc.). The best conditions reported for surf at St Brevin l'Ermitage occur when a West-southwest swell combines with an offshore wind direction from the East-northeast. The best time of year for surfing St Brevin l'Ermitage with consistent clean waves (rideable swell with light / offshore winds) is during Spring and most often the month of March.
